Consider the Given Isosceles Triangle
Considering the Possibilities
Case 1. When two equal angles are of 70°
Let the third angle be x.
Keeping in mind , that sum of Interior angles of Triangle is 180°.
70° + 70° + x= 180°
140° +x= 180°
x= 180°- 140°
x= 40°
Case 2:
When an angle measures 70°, and two equal angles measure x°.
Keeping the same property of triangle in mind, that is sum of interior angles of triangle is 180°.
70° + x° + x° = 180°
⇒ 70° + 2 x° = 180°
⇒ 2 x° = 180° - 70°
⇒ 2 x° = 110°
Dividing both sides by 2, we get
x= 55°
